April 8, 2025

Site Security Best Practices Every Designer Need To Follow

Introduction

In the digital age, website security is a vital concern for designers and developers alike. With cyber risks looming large, understanding and implementing robust security practices has ended up being not just a choice but a need. Website Security Best Practices Every Designer Need To Follow is essential for anybody involved in website design, guaranteeing that user information and site stability remain secure.

As a site designer in California, you might be tasked with developing aesthetically sensational and functional sites-- but what great is a lovely style if it's vulnerable to hackers? This article will direct you through numerous elements of website security, from standard practices to innovative methods. So buckle up as we look into the world of web security!

Understanding Site Security

What Is Website Security?

Website security describes the measures required to secure websites from cyber risks. It includes Full-stack web development Bay Area both preventative and responsive strategies developed to protect delicate data versus unapproved gain access to, attacks, and other destructive activities.

Why Is Website Security Important?

  • Protects User Data: Sites often gather personal details from users. A breach could lead to identity theft.
  • Maintains Trust: Users are most likely to abandon websites they perceive as insecure.
  • Prevents Downtime: Cyber attacks can cause significant downtime, impacting business operations.

Common Types of Cyber Threats

  • Malware Attacks: Software application designed to disrupt or get unauthorized access.
  • Phishing: Technique users into supplying sensitive information by masquerading as a trustworthy entity.
  • DDoS Attacks: Overwhelm a site with traffic to render it unusable.
  • Website Security Best Practices Every Designer Need To Follow

    1. Use HTTPS Instead of HTTP

    Securing your site with HTTPS guarantees that all data transferred between the server and user is secured. This is vital for securing delicate details like passwords and credit card numbers.

    Why You Need to Switch:

    • Increases user trust
    • Improves SEO rankings

    2. Frequently Update Software and Plugins

    Outdated software application can be an entrance for attackers. Routine updates spot vulnerabilities that hackers might exploit.

    How To Handle Updates:

    • Enable automatic updates where possible.
    • Schedule routine examine your website components.

    3. Carry Out Strong Password Policies

    A strong password policy makes it harder for assailants to gain access to your site. Encourage using complex passwords with a mix of letters, numbers, and symbols.

    Tips for Strong Passwords:

    • Avoid quickly guessable words.
    • Change passwords regularly.

    4. Make Use Of Two-Factor Authentication (2FA)

    Adding an additional layer of security through 2FA can significantly lower the threat of unapproved access.

    Benefits of 2FA:

    • Enhances account protection
    • Deters brute-force attacks

    5. Conduct Regular Security Audits

    Regular audits allow you to recognize potential vulnerabilities before they can be exploited.

    Steps for Reliable Audits:

  • Use automated tools for scanning vulnerabilities.
  • Review user authorizations periodically.
  • 6. Safeguard Against SQL Injection Attacks

    SQL injection is one of the most typical types of website attacks aimed at databases where malicious SQL code is placed into queries.

    Prevention Procedures:

    • Utilize prepared statements and parameterized queries.
    • Employ saved treatments instead of vibrant queries.

    7. Execute Material Security Policy (CSP)

    CSP helps prevent cross-site scripting (XSS) attacks by managing which resources can load on your site.

    How To Establish CSP:

  • Specify enabled sources for scripts, images, etc.
  • Enforce CSP through HTTP headers or meta tags in HTML files.
  • 8. Install Web Application Firewall Programs (WAF)

    A WAF serves as a filter in between your web application and the web, obstructing harmful traffic before it reaches your server.

    Benefits:

    • Provides real-time protection
    • Customizable guidelines based upon specific needs

    9. Usage Secure Hosting Services

    Choose trusted web hosting services that focus on security features like firewall programs, malware scanning, and backup solutions.

    What To Look For In Hosting:

  • SSL certificates included
  • 24/ 7 support for instant assistance
  • 10. Educate Your Group on Security Best Practices

    Your group ought to understand the importance of security in web design; this includes knowledge about phishing plans and protected coding standards.

    Ways To Educate:

    • Conduct regular training sessions
    • Share resources like posts or videos focusing on cybersecurity

    11. Display User Activity Logs

    Keeping an eye on user activity can assist spot unusual behavior indicative of unauthorized access attempts or possible breaches.

    What To Track:

  • Login attempts
  • Changes made by users with admin privileges
  • 12. Limit User Gain Access To Levels

    Not all users need complete access; limitation permissions based upon roles within your company or job scope.

    Benefits Of Limiting Gain access to:

    • Reduces potential damage from jeopardized accounts
    • Simplifies auditing processes

    13. Backup Your Data Regularly

    Regular backups ensure that you can restore your website quickly in case of an attack or information loss incident.

    Backup Techniques:

  • Use automated backup solutions.
  • Store backups offsite or in cloud storage services.
  • 14. Use Secure Cookies

    Cookies are often utilized for session management however can likewise be made use of if not dealt with securely.

    How To Protect Cookies:

  • Set cookies with the Secure attribute so they're only sent out over HTTPS connections.
  • Add HttpOnly credit to avoid JavaScript access to cookie data.
  • 15: Stay Informed About Emerging Threats

    Cybersecurity is an ever-evolving field; staying notified about new dangers enables you to adjust proactively instead of reactively.

    Resources For Remaining Updated:

    1. Sign up for cybersecurity newsletters 2. Follow industry leaders on social media platforms

    FAQ Section

    Q: What are some typical indications my site has actually been hacked?

    A: Unusual activity such as unanticipated modifications in content or redirects, increased traffic from strange sources, or notifications from online search engine about malware warnings can suggest hacking events.

    Q: Is it necessary to have an SSL certificate?

    A: Yes! An SSL certificate encrypts information transferred between your server and users' web browsers, enhancing trustworthiness and improving SEO rankings.

    Q: How often need to I upgrade my website's software?

    A: Ideally, software application should be upgraded frequently-- a minimum of as soon as a month or immediately after brand-new releases attending to critical security vulnerabilities are issued.

    Q: Can I perform security audits myself?

    A: While do it yourself audits are possible using numerous tools readily available online, expert penetration screening supplies deeper insights into possible vulnerabilities within your system.

    Q: How do I know if my hosting provider focuses on security?

    A: Search for features such as built-in firewall softwares, routine backups used by default, 24/7 technical support schedule concentrated on securing sites against threats.

    Q: What should I do if I presume my site has actually been compromised?

    A: Right away alter all passwords associated with it; call your hosting provider/IT group; evaluate damage by reviewing logs before restoring backups effectively.

    Conclusion

    Navigating the world of site security may appear intimidating initially glimpse-- especially when managing aesthetic appeals alongside functionality-- however adhering strictly to these best practices will not only safeguard valuable data however likewise foster trust amongst users visiting your websites daily! Keep in mind that protecting versus cyber dangers requires ongoing caution-- so keep discovering emerging dangers while remaining proactive toward enhancing existing defenses!

    By following these thorough standards under " Website Security Finest Practices Every Designer Should Follow," you're well on your way toward developing protected sites that stand resistant against modern-day challenges dealt with by designers everywhere!

    I am a dynamic innovator with a broad knowledge base in entrepreneurship. My conviction in entrepreneurship spurs my desire to innovate disruptive organizations. In my business career, I have cultivated a profile as being a daring thinker. Aside from creating my own businesses, I also enjoy counseling young startup founders. I believe in empowering the next generation of startup founders to pursue their own aspirations. I am easily seeking out disruptive opportunities and working together with similarly-driven creators. Redefining what's possible is my purpose. Aside from engaged in my enterprise, I enjoy immersing myself in dynamic environments. I am also focused on health and wellness.